Victory In Absentia:The Daily Telegraph's libel action appeal against George Galloway has been dismissed.
Mr Galloway successfully sued the newspaper in 2004 for alleging that he had received a portion of Iraq's oil revenues, worth £375,000, from Saddam Hussein's regime.
The Telegraph was ordered to pay £1.2m legal costs and £150,000 in damages.
